How Sewer Gas Build-Up Impacts Indoor Air Quality

Sewer gas is a complex mixture of gases produced during the decomposition of organic materials in sewage systems. It typically contains methane, hydrogen sulfide, ammonia, and other potentially hazardous compounds. When sewer gas leaks into indoor environments, it can significantly impact air quality and pose risks to the health and safety of occupants.

This article explores how sewer gas build-up occurs, its effects on indoor air quality, and the potential health hazards associated with prolonged exposure.

What Causes Sewer Gas Build-Up Indoors?

Sewer gas leaks and build-up inside buildings are typically the result of plumbing system malfunctions or maintenance issues. Learn more. Common causes include:

  • Dry P-Traps: The U-shaped pipe under sinks, known as the P-trap, is designed to hold water, creating a seal that prevents sewer gas from entering the home. If the P-trap dries out due to infrequent use, this barrier is broken, allowing gas to escape.
  • Broken Sewer Lines: Damaged or cracked sewer pipes beneath the home can allow gas to seep into the structure.
  • Ventilation Blockages: Plumbing systems rely on vent pipes to release sewer gases outside. If these vents become clogged by debris, leaves, or nests, gas pressure can force the fumes into indoor spaces.
  • Improper Installation: Faulty plumbing installations, such as poorly connected pipes or missing seals, can result in sewer gas leaks.

The Effects of Sewer Gas on Indoor Air Quality

When sewer gas enters indoor spaces, it can drastically degrade air quality. The following are the primary ways sewer gas impacts indoor environments:

1. Odor Contamination

Sewer gas has a distinctive, unpleasant smell, primarily due to the presence of hydrogen sulfide. Even small leaks can fill indoor spaces with foul odors, making the environment uncomfortable and uninhabitable.

2. Increased Toxicity

Sewer gas contains hazardous substances like methane and ammonia. These gases can accumulate in enclosed spaces, creating a toxic environment that poses immediate health risks to occupants.

3. Reduced Oxygen Levels

Methane, a significant component of sewer gas, displaces oxygen in enclosed spaces. In poorly ventilated areas, this can lead to oxygen depletion, which may cause dizziness, fatigue, or even suffocation in extreme cases.

4. Moisture and Mold Growth

Sewer gas leaks often coincide with moisture problems, such as leaks in sewer pipes. Excess moisture can create the perfect conditions for mold growth, further degrading indoor air quality and posing additional health risks.

5. Corrosion of Metal Surfaces

Ammonia in sewer gas can corrode metal surfaces and fixtures, such as HVAC systems, electrical components, and plumbing fixtures. This can lead to further maintenance issues and increased repair costs.

Health Risks Associated with Sewer Gas Exposure

Exposure to sewer gas can lead to a range of short- and long-term health effects, depending on the concentration and duration of exposure:

  • Respiratory Irritation: Hydrogen sulfide irritates the respiratory system, leading to symptoms like coughing, throat irritation, and difficulty breathing.
  • Headaches and Nausea: The unpleasant odor of sewer gas can trigger headaches, dizziness, and nausea in sensitive individuals.
  • Fatigue and Drowsiness: Methane exposure can cause fatigue and drowsiness due to oxygen displacement.
  • Severe Health Risks: High concentrations of hydrogen sulfide can lead to more severe health issues, including unconsciousness or even death in extreme cases.
  • Aggravation of Pre-Existing Conditions: Individuals with asthma, allergies, or other respiratory conditions are particularly vulnerable to the effects of sewer gas exposure.

Preventing Sewer Gas Build-Up Indoors

Maintaining a properly functioning plumbing system is essential to preventing sewer gas leaks and build-up - Go here. Steps to mitigate the risk include:

  • Regular Maintenance: Regularly inspect and maintain plumbing fixtures, including P-traps, vent pipes, and sewer lines, to ensure they function correctly.
  • Use Fixtures Regularly: Ensure that water remains in P-traps by running water in infrequently used sinks, toilets, and floor drains.
  • Address Vent Blockages: Check and clear plumbing vents of any debris or obstructions to allow sewer gases to escape outdoors.
  • Seal Cracks and Openings: Repair any cracks or damage in sewer pipes to prevent gas seepage.
  • Professional Inspections: Schedule routine inspections by licensed plumbers to identify and address potential issues before they escalate.

Neuse Township, North Carolina, is a growing suburban area located in the northeastern part of Wake County, just outside Raleigh, offering a mix of residential developments, natural beauty, and convenient access to the broader Research Triangle region. Known for its quiet neighborhoods, excellent schools, and strong sense of community, Neuse Township is an appealing place to live for families, young professionals, and retirees looking for a balance between suburban tranquility and urban amenities. The area is named after the nearby Neuse River, which serves as one of its most defining natural features, providing stunning waterfront views and a variety of outdoor recreational opportunities. One of the most popular attractions in the township is the Neuse River Greenway Trail, a scenic 27.5-mile paved trail that winds along the river, offering picturesque routes for walking, running, and cycling while providing access to wetlands, forests, and beautiful open spaces where visitors can spot wildlife and enjoy peaceful nature walks. Outdoor enthusiasts can also take advantage of kayaking and fishing opportunities along the Neuse River, with several public access points allowing for a relaxing day on the water. In addition to its natural beauty, Neuse Township is home to a variety of parks and recreational spaces, including Horseshoe Farm Nature Preserve, a 146-acre park that features rolling meadows, scenic trails, and picnic areas, making it an excellent destination for families and nature lovers seeking a quiet escape from the busy city life. Nearby, Buffalo Road Athletic Park provides sports fields, playgrounds, and open spaces for soccer, baseball, and other recreational activities, catering to athletes of all ages.
